The following six persons will be appearing in bail court this morning:

1. Peter McDonald, age 37, of 382 Pim St. It is alleged that on Friday March 7th the Sault Ste Marie Police Service Internet Child Exploitation Unit (I.C.E. UNIT) was executing a search warrant on Mr. McDonald’s computer when they discovered several images of child pornography. As a result Mr. McDonald has been charged with one count of possession of child pornography. The investigation into this matter is continuing.

2. A 51-year-old male is charged with one count of an indecent act, two counts of sexual assault and two counts of criminal harassment. It is alleged that the accused did between September 2007 and March 2008 sexually assault two young girls. It is further alleged that the during the same time period the accused harassed the two young girls, on several occasion, by walking in on the girls while they were in the bathroom. It is also alleged that between September 2007 and March 2008 the accused indecently exposed himself to the girls.

3. A 36-year-old female is charged with one count of assault. It is alleged that on Friday March 7th at approx. 4:00 pm the accused punched her common-law partner several times to the head. The victim did not require medical attention. The incident took place at the west end residence of the accused.

4. Jordan Porter, age 18, of 603 Second Line W. Unit # 4 is charged with one count of obstruct police and five counts of breach of probation. It is alleged that on Saturday March 8th at approx. 3:40 am the accused consumed alcohol, was out past his curfew time, was in the company of a person that he was prohibited from being with and failed to keep the peace. It is further alleged that the accused falsely identified himself to police.

5. A 17-year-old male is charged with three counts of breach of probation. It is alleged that on Sunday March 9th at approx. 12:45 am the accused was located on Pine St. in an intoxicated condition. At the time of this offence the accused was on probation with conditions that he not consume alcohol, remain in his residence from 11:00 pm to 7:00 am and that he keep the peace and be good.

6. A 57-year-old male is charged with one count of threatening, two counts of breach of probation and one
count of breach of a recognizance. It is alleged that on Sunday March 9th the accused threatened to burn down his ex-wife’s residence. At the time of the offence the accused was on a probation order and a recognizance peace bond to not molest, harass or annoy the victim.

Possession of a dangerous weapon & Assault

On Friday March 7th at approx. 9:15 pm Alan Bertrand, age 22, of 6 Linden Dr., Heyden turned himself in to the Sault Ste Marie Police Service and was charged with one count of possession of a weapon dangerous to the public, one count of assault with a weapon causing bodily harm and one count of assault causing bodily harm. It is alleged that at approx. 2:30 pm on Friday March 7th the accused and another male person attended at a west end bar and while there they assaulted a male known to them with a baseball bat. Both accused fled the scene prior to police arrival. The victim of the assault was taken to the Sault Area Hospital and treated for a broken leg. A warrant is being issued for the second suspect. Mr. Bertrand will be appearing in court on April 7th at 9:00 am.

Impaired Driving

On Friday March 8th at approx. 5:10 am city police arrested 18-year-old Jeremy Teresinski of 1412 Airport Rd and charged him with one count of impaired driving and one count of drive over 80mgs.It is alleged that on Friday March 8th at approx. 4:45 am a witness observed the accused was operating his vehicle on Base Line in an erratic manner. Police were called and upon arrival observed the accused to be impaired by alcohol. The accused will be appearing in court on April 7th at 9:00 am.

Assult at the Rosie

On Saturday March 8th at approx. 1:35 am city police arrested Jeremy Barnes, age 27, of 289 Kingsford Rd. and charged him with two counts of assault and one count of assault causing bodily harm. It is alleged that at approx. 1:00 am on March 8th the accused assaulted two females and one male while at the Roosevelt Hotel. The two female victims were pushed and punched but did not require medical attention. The male victim suffered numerous cuts and bruises to the face and head area and was transported to the Sault Area Hospital for treatment. Mr. Barnes will be appearing in court on April 14th at 9:00 am.


The Sault Ste Marie Police Service investigated three reports of break and enters this past weekend.

1) An attempted break-in took place at a residence in the 200 block of Wellington St.E. on March 8th at approx. 11:20 pm.

2) A residence in the 100 block of Goulais Ave. was entered on march 9th between 10:00 pm and 11:00 pm. Electronic equipment and DVDs were stolen.

3) The Algonquin Hotel, 864 Queen St.E. was entered and a quantity of cash was stolen from the safe. Entry took place after closing on Saturday night March 8th to early morning March 9th.
